Halogen bonding—a key step in charge recombination of the dye-sensitized solar cell

Abstract
The halogen bonding between [Ru(dcbpy)2(SCN)2] dye and I2 molecule has been studied. The ruthenium complex forms a stable [Ru(dcbpy)2(SCN)2]⋯I2·4(CH3OH) adduct via S⋯I interaction between the thiocyanate ligand and the I2 molecule. The adduct can be seen as a model for one of the key intermediates in the regeneration cycle of the oxidized dye by the I/I3 electrolyte in dye sensitized solar cells.
